Las leyendas: el origen (English: Legend Quest: The Origin) is a 2022 Mexican animated comedy horror film directed by Ricardo Arnaiz. It serves as a prequel to the Leyendas franchise taking place before La Leyenda de la Nahuala and is produced by Ánima. The film is an origin story focused on the little Calavera duo, Finado and Moribunda, who must leave their home in Pueblo Calaca while looking out for a human baby.[4][5]

Las leyendas: el origen was released on the streaming platform ViX platform on 10 August 2022.[6][7] The film was initially planned for a theatrical release in 2020 in Mexico, but was cancelled due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
Premise
Two Calavera children must look after a human infant after crossing through an eternal mirror, absorbing energy of a portal that separates the worlds between life and death.

Development
Ricardo Arnaiz, the creator of the Leyendas characters, served as the director of the film, marking his return to the franchise since The Legend of La Nahuala and his first collaboration outside of Animex Producciones.[10] The film was originally titled tentatively as The Legend of... and then The Legend of Finado and Moribunda.[11] The film was first teased on social media.[12][13]

Sequel
The film is succeeded by La leyenda de los Chaneques, which was also released on Vix on 14 July 2023.[16]
